South Texas College is hiring a Videographer based in McAllen, Texas, to join its Communication and Creative Services department. This role sits inside an in-house production unit responsible for short and long form video content spanning commercials, program profiles, and interview-driven editorial pieces distributed across YouTube, web, and social media platforms. It suits a working shooter-editor who is comfortable operating across the full video production workflow, from pre-production planning through to final delivery.
About the Role
Reporting to the Video Production Coordinator, this Videographer works inside a college media team producing institutional content that functions more like a small broadcast unit than a traditional marketing department. Projects range from on-location interview packages and educational vignettes to longer promotional productions, with the role covering camera, audio, lighting, and post in a single-operator or small crew context. A typical day might involve pulling a call sheet for a student profile shoot, running a field interview setup, and returning to organize and back up footage in a structured post-production workflow.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ist the Video Production Coordinator through all stages of production, including developing concepts, producing, directing, and editing short and long form video projects.
- Operate as camera operator, audio technician, lighting technician, and grip as required to meet production quality standards on location and in studio.
- Build and maintain production documentation including call sheets, shot lists, and equipment procurement schedules for each project.
- Conduct on-camera interviews with students, faculty, staff, alumni, and campus visitors, with a focus on capturing usable sound bites in field recording conditions.
- Catalog, back up, and maintain organized archives of all video and photographic footage.
- Transport, set up, and operate production equipment for field and studio shoots, including minor troubleshooting and routine equipment maintenance.
What You Bring
- Associate’s degree in Video Production, Communication, Marketing, or a related field is required; a Bachelor’s degree is preferred.
- At least two years of professional video production experience across field and studio environments.
- Working knowledge of digital Sony camcorder and mirrorless camera systems, with experience on Sony FS700 and FS5 Mark II considered a strong asset.
- Hands-on experience with field audio recording and location lighting setups.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office and internet research tools within a Windows environment.
